The Winnipeg General Strike of 1919
from Stuff You Missed in History Class · host iHeartPodcasts
The 1919 strike is the largest in Canada’s history, and shut Winnipeg down. While the strike started out as a simple labor dispute, there were many factors involved in how it played out, and a conspiracy theory that it was a communist uprising.
